This is a nice old historical hotel from a converted boarding house (some say it was also a brothel in years gone by). The lady who runs the place was very nice and friendly. I enjoyed the historical and cowboy photos and artifacts. As an historical building, it has a creaky old wooden staircase and creaky wooden floors. The rooms... More

If you are looking for the Holiday Inn, you probably don't want to stay here. If you want to experience reality in southeastern Colorado this might be the place for you. It is a lot like a bed and breakfast without the breakfast. The room was clean, adequate and comfortable. The floors in the hall squeak like in an old... More

Not much in this small town. This hotel is old and in need of improvements. There is a funky smell in the lobby area and on into the rooms. Rooms are adequate but old. Bathroom had a hole in the wall and the hole was stuffed with a paper towel. The other accomodations in town do not look any better... More

Reasonable in the sense that there's just not much else here, and reasonably clean. Property overall is in poor shape, drywall stacked up in the hallway, needs a lot of work. Plumbing in pretty bad shape (scary stuff in sink drain).Cheap, but you get what you pay for. Owner was nice. More
